The range of grass mixtures for creating lawns is not easy to understand even for specialists. On sale you can find not dozens, but hundreds of varieties of lawns that differ in grass composition and declared characteristics, required care and resistance to stress. The only reliable guideline in choosing a lawn is the basic criteria, or types of grass mixtures. They determine the conditions necessary for growing green carpets, and the possibility of their use, and the specifics of care.

Today, even in the line of one manufacturer, you can find not a few varieties of lawns, but many of their names. When choosing a specific grass mixture for a lawn, it is sometimes impossible to understand what the difference between the individual options is. But if it is difficult to navigate in the offers presented on the market, then it is quite easy to determine what type and type of lawn you need. The basic type of lawn outlines a list of all the key characteristics of these emerald carpets and determines their functional purpose. Having decided on it, you can safely study the assortment of the presented varieties and seek professional advice.

Garden lawns are divided into 5 types:

  1. Ground lawns
  2. Common lawns
  3. Sports lawns
  4. Moorish or flowering lawns
  5. Shady lawns
  6. Alternative or non-grassy lawns

Rolled lawns are often attributed to the types of lawn. But this is more of a type, or kind of technology for creating lawns, and not a separate species. Rolled lawns are also ground or ordinary, athletic and even shade-tolerant. Choosing a sowing lawn or laying rolls will require both different preparation and different care. But the roll lawn should not be called a separate type of emerald grounds.

Front ground lawns

Ground lawns are also rightly called ceremonial. These are really lawns, playing the role of a purely decorative one, that is, as a decoration and an impeccable green carpet. They really look like living velvet, they are the most prestigious and aesthetically attractive view of green lawns. They do not walk on the ground grass, they are unstable to the load, and even the games of animals can violate their ideal state.

Ground grass is most often used where you need to create a "perfect picture." They are placed in the front garden, near the house, at the ceremonial flower beds, emphasizing their beauty with the best of objects of small architecture and garden sculpture. At the same time, there is only one rule in creating ground grass - their area should exceed the area of ​​decorative compositions located nearby, and those objects that they “shade”.

The main advantages of ground grass:

  • smooth and dense coating;
  • flawless emerald color;
  • highest decorativeness.

Ground grass is created from elite grass mixtures consisting of meadow bluegrass and timothy with addition ryegrass, field trees and fescue red.

Ordinary or landscape gardening lawns

A lawn that can withstand a certain load, but at the same time decorative enough to remain an adornment of a site that does not require complicated maintenance and creates a classic coating, is an ordinary or garden lawn. It is such lawns that are created in urban squares and parks, they are stable, but lacking endurance to heavy loads and absolute impeccability, this is a kind of intermediate option between sports and ground lawns, a compromise between aesthetics and practicality.

The main advantages of ordinary lawns

  • universality;
  • unpretentiousness;
  • the ability to create an emerald carpet on complex terrain;
  • seed availability.

Ordinary lawns are created mainly from common field and field comb. To enhance endurance, this mixture is added red fescue, pasture ryegrass and bluegrass meadow.

Sports ultra-hardy lawns

Special types of lawns that can withstand even a constant heavy load, not for nothing called sports. These are the lawns that create for golf courses, playgrounds and sports competitions.

Among sports mixes, football, tennis, golf and lawn for playgrounds are separately distinguished, but all of them are characterized by almost the same high endurance. They require very unusual and thorough care, low mowing, and for private gardens such lawns are very rare.

Sports lawns are planted or created from rolled lawns. A special drainage is laid for them and irrigation is carefully thought out, any failures in which will lead to a rapid loss of decorativeness of the green carpet.

The main advantages of sports lawns:

  • resistance to heavy loads and active movement;
  • dense texture;
  • low grass.

Sports lawns are sown from mixtures consisting of pasture ryegrass, meadow grass and meadow fescue. The seed rate for such lawns is 1.5-2 times greater than when creating any other lawn. And the mixtures themselves are one of the most expensive.

Moorish lawn

The most colorful and picturesque of all types of lawns is known as Moorish, although with no less right it can be called a flowering lawn. This is a unique type of lawn cover created not only with cereals, but also with flowering or ornamental plants. It is easy to create and even easier to care for.

Today, a meadow lawn is often isolated separately from the Moorish, in which cereals remain the dominant plants, but mainly local herbs are used, reinforced by groundcover, cultivated plants, and some flowering herbs. But according to the peculiarities of creation, and also according to aesthetic characteristics, meadow and Moorish lawns are difficult to distinguish.

The main advantages of flowering lawns:

  • fit perfectly into landscape styles;
  • do not require complicated care;
  • easy to grow;
  • colorful;
  • attract honey plants and butterflies.

Seeds are added to ordinary lawn grasses, which still remain the basis of the Moorish lawn. forget-me-nots, resident, clover, carnations, poppy, daisies, flax, bells and other wildflowers.

Shade-tolerant lawns

Emerald carpets that can withstand shading and still look like a luxurious lawn are used for landscaping problem areas in the garden. They are often called lawn lifters, allowing you to arrange even unsightly places.

The main advantages of shady lawns:

  • allow you to create a classic design even on not too well-lit areas, including under trees;
  • great stamina;
  • simplified care;
  • fast growth.

Shade-tolerant plants are created from especially hardy, which have undergone a special selection of classical lawn cereals or ground cover plants - periwinkle, survivors, hoof. Today, moss lawns are very popular.

Grassy lawns

All types of lawn imitations created using not cereal grasses but ground cover plants are called non-grassy lawns. They are broken up to simplify garden maintenance, filling large areas without much effort, or when they want to emphasize the style of garden design with a carpet of special texture.

The main advantages of non-grassy lawns:

- natural, miraculous appearance;
- attracts honey plants and insects;
- they are easy to create;
- such lawns require almost no maintenance;
- the choice of different types of plants allows you to achieve different decorative effects.

Non-grassy lawns are created from soil protectors, which are suitable for lighting and soil characteristics. Favorites - Veronica, acena, periwinkle, tenacity, European hoof, thyme, awl-shaped phlox, clover, etc. A separate type of grassy lawn is the area covered with moss.

In addition to the basic types of lawns today on sale you can find other types of lawn grass mixtures. Quickly restored lawns are used in the repair and correction of existing lawns. For clay soils, roadsides and other heavily polluted territories, urban conditions, and arid regions, there are special seed mixtures.
